First visit largely positive. Although not really anticipating a great deal, despite having noted several laudatory reviews, the breakfast was certainly acceptable, and as it included both toast and a hot drink, was good value at £5.30. My very elderly father had a jacket potato with beans, and whilst he usually has a very limited appetite, he professed himself satisfied having demolished a large spud! Staff also pleasant and helpful. There is also a large selection of cakes and pies that could be worth exploring. If you are in the area, this cafe is worth a visit for simple straightforward food at very reasonable price.
